Output 598c46d972554f2fe04fded70c443f8af33dea14591f234e97a1a2661494ee51:1

value
1020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a43256020cf2e0bed6849f34095176e2ab8c4e6 OP_EQUAL
address
3CqUoLFnmfrHzVPy2DPzo6jHvwsyQGB3SE
transaction
598c46d972554f2fe04fded70c443f8af33dea14591f234e97a1a2661494ee51
spent
true